flag Supreme Court narrows federal obstruction statute application in 300+ Capitol riot cases.

flag The Supreme Court ruled that prosecutors misused an obstruction law in charging hundreds of rioters who attacked the Capitol on Jan 6, 2021. flag The decision narrows the Justice Department's use of a federal obstruction statute in 300+ cases related to the Capitol riot. flag The 6-3 ruling raises the bar for charging someone with obstruction, stating that the government must show that the defendant impaired the availability or integrity of records, documents, or other objects used in an official proceeding.
